Output 1ec0b63256d09f19fa977029636fb6670324055a3928312310a78f8a23c3e15f:0

value
1508006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455eef9cba59789f42055aa7b7c4402ce596b1d9 OP_EQUAL
address
381pH3jYebwcNMAo2XsRgPReLY9dpk7HZS
transaction
1ec0b63256d09f19fa977029636fb6670324055a3928312310a78f8a23c3e15f
spent
true